Line Lead
The Line Lead is responsible for ensuring that the assigned line/cell is running in an efficient manner. Finds solutions to problems that occur while the cell is in production and is a liaison to Operations Performance Manager. He/she ensures production operators receive required on the job instructions to be successful and supported in their role. Identifies if formal training or instruction is needed and communicates to leaders and training team to ensure employee is supported.

Communicates issues, priorities, and workflow to Operations Performance Manager and supervisor at shift start and throughout. Promotes Good Manufacturing Processes and food safety practices among production operators. Manages accurate shift reporting, handoffs, and workflow updates. Monitors procedure execution by production operators. Addresses process halts, quality concerns, and compliance issues. Validates completion of HACCP and safety checks. Ensures equipment performance and organized work areas.
Stays updated on standards impacting the line/cell. Validates employee knowledge and skills, offers feedback. Tracks training requirements and maintains records. Ensures accurate training materials and documentation. Collaborates on training matrices and resource planning. Provides input to improve documentation and consistency. Coordinates coverage for required training. Collaborates on refining standard procedures for productivity, safety, and quality. Participates in focus groups and leads improvement initiatives.
Identifies performance improvement opportunities and communicates them. Drives implementation of new procedures and company initiatives. Provides coaching and feedback to improve team performance. Coaches production operators on tasks and behaviors. May fill in for Production Supervisor on an as needed basis.
